FX/Hulu continues their winning television streak with The Patient, a true two-hander starring Steve Carell and Domhnall Gleeson. If you've seen any marketing of the show, you'll know the high-concept premise. A serial killer abducts a therapist to try and get himself cured. A criminal goes undercover in a prison to try and get a serial killer to confess to where he's buried dead bodies... before an appeal may set the killer free. Apple+.
